Searched refs:ExtraArgTs (Results 1 – 6 of 6) sorted by relevance
/external/swiftshader/third_party/llvm-7.0/llvm/include/llvm/IR/ |
D | PassManager.h | 359 template <typename IRUnitT, typename... ExtraArgTs> class AnalysisManager; 419 typename... ExtraArgTs> 421 PassManager<IRUnitT, AnalysisManagerT, ExtraArgTs...>> { 445 ExtraArgTs... ExtraArgs) { in run() 488 ExtraArgTs...>; in addPass() 495 detail::PassConcept<IRUnitT, AnalysisManagerT, ExtraArgTs...>; 518 template <typename IRUnitT, typename... ExtraArgTs> class AnalysisManager { 528 ExtraArgTs...>; 687 typename PassT::Result &getResult(IRUnitT &IR, ExtraArgTs... ExtraArgs) { in getResult() 743 Invalidator, ExtraArgTs...>; in registerPass() [all …]
|
D | PassManagerInternal.h | 29 template <typename IRUnitT, typename... ExtraArgTs> class AnalysisManager; 37 template <typename IRUnitT, typename AnalysisManagerT, typename... ExtraArgTs> 48 ExtraArgTs... ExtraArgs) = 0; 60 typename AnalysisManagerT, typename... ExtraArgTs> 61 struct PassModel : PassConcept<IRUnitT, AnalysisManagerT, ExtraArgTs...> { 79 ExtraArgTs... ExtraArgs) override { in run() 240 typename... ExtraArgTs> 249 run(IRUnitT &IR, AnalysisManager<IRUnitT, ExtraArgTs...> &AM, 250 ExtraArgTs... ExtraArgs) = 0; 262 typename InvalidatorT, typename... ExtraArgTs> [all …]
|
D | IRPrintingPasses.h | 34 template <typename IRUnitT, typename... ExtraArgTs> class AnalysisManager;
|
/external/swiftshader/third_party/llvm-7.0/llvm/unittests/IR/ |
D | PassBuilderCallbacksTest.cpp | 50 typename... ExtraArgTs> 81 Result run(IRUnitT &IR, AnalysisManagerT &AM, ExtraArgTs... ExtraArgs) { in run() 106 run(_, _, testing::Matcher<ExtraArgTs>(_)...)) in setDefaults() 120 typename... ExtraArgTs> 122 ExtraArgTs...>::Analysis::Key; 126 typename... ExtraArgTs> 141 ExtraArgTs... ExtraArgs) { in run() 154 run(_, _, testing::Matcher<ExtraArgTs>(_)...)) in setDefaults()
|
/external/swiftshader/third_party/llvm-7.0/llvm/include/llvm/Passes/ |
D | PassBuilder.h | 659 typename... ExtraArgTs> 662 PassManager<IRUnitT, AnalysisManagerT, ExtraArgTs...> &PM) { in parseAnalysisUtilityPasses() 680 ExtraArgTs...>()); in parseAnalysisUtilityPasses()
|
/external/swiftshader/third_party/llvm-7.0/llvm/unittests/Transforms/Scalar/ |
D | LoopPassManagerTest.cpp | 50 typename... ExtraArgTs> 81 Result run(IRUnitT &IR, AnalysisManagerT &AM, ExtraArgTs... ExtraArgs) { in run() 106 run(_, _, testing::Matcher<ExtraArgTs>(_)...)) in setDefaults() 114 typename... ExtraArgTs> 116 ExtraArgTs...>::Analysis::Key; 161 typename... ExtraArgTs> 176 ExtraArgTs... ExtraArgs) { in run() 189 run(_, _, testing::Matcher<ExtraArgTs>(_)...)) in setDefaults()
|